I have a lot of programs that on a cold start, have to
wait for them to load which can take several minutes and
then they put their icon in the sys tray. Many of these
programs I don't need at that time and have to go to sys
tray and close them out. If needed, I can then go to the
main program lists.
How can I stop these programs from loading on start ups?

Try the free Startup Manager
http://f2.org/archive/software/startupmgr.html

You can disable whichever programs you don't want starting up... if you want
them back, you can easily re-enable them.
